Why the Broken Vessel’s Audio Hits Different

As someone who lives on rhythm, ambience, and the subtle emotional cues sound design can create, the Broken Vessel’s audio always stood out to me. This boss isn’t just an enemy it’s a fallen sibling, a tragic echo of what the Knight could’ve become. Every slash, shriek, and infected pulse tells a story.

In building this collection for SoundBoardW.net, I wanted to capture that emotional weight. The fluttering void energy, the frantic mobility, the corrupted essence bursting through its cracked shell—every sound button in this SoundBoard brings players right back into that haunting chamber.
